I thank the gentleman for pointing that out, and reclaiming my time, we've already done work to show the direction we can go to head off this absolute disaster for our national defense. It is in the hands of the Democratic-controlled Senate. It is in the hands of the majority leader in the Senate, and it is time for him to put the partisan politics aside and fund our military and make the cuts across other areas. Let's keep to our word to make cuts. Let's don't break that word, but let's don't destroy the military and violate the Constitution, which says we are supposed to provide for the common defense of this country. You know, sometimes we get kind of provincial in this country, so just for the fun of it, let's talk a little bit about all those jobs, who's going to lose those jobs. Let me put that chart up here. Potential job losses across the board: California, 125,800; Virginia, 122,800; Texas, 91,600; Florida, 39,200; Massachusetts, 38,200; Maryland, 36,200; Pennsylvania, 36,200; Connecticut, 34,200; Arizona, 33,200; Missouri, 31,200. That's the top. That's the top 10, I think it is. But the truth is the defense industry and those who provide for the defense industry are a major part of our economy. We're all going to feel this. But if you're one of those States, and you're already worried about where are your kids, when they get out of school, going to get a job with jobs being lost, look at that list and see that we're all in this together.…
